Indiana University names five finalists for dean position
Indiana University
November 29, 2010
An Indiana University Bloomington search committee has recommended five finalists for the position of dean of the College of Arts and Sciences, and campus visits by the candidates will begin this week.
The five candidates include:
Robert A. Becker, executive associate dean of the College of Arts and Sciences and professor of economics at IU Bloomington
Joan Herbers, professor of evolution, ecology and organismal biology and former dean of the College of Biological Sciences at The Ohio State University
Catherine A. Pilachowski, associate dean for graduate education of the College of Arts and Sciences and professor and Kirkwood Chair in astronomy, IU Bloomington
Greg B. Simpson, professor of psychology and former interim dean of the College of Liberal Arts and Sciences, University of Kansas
Larry D. Singell, associate dean for social sciences in the College of Arts and Sciences and professor of economics, University of Oregon
